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roof to identify any existing or potential issues. Skilled contractors examine the roof’s surface, looking for signs of wear, missing or damaged shingles, leaks, and other structural concerns. This process often includes inspecting the attic and interior spaces for water intrusion, mold, or structural problems that may not be immediately visible from the outside. The goal is to provide homeowners with a clear understanding of the roof’s condition, enabling informed decisions about repairs, maintenance, or replacements.
These inspections are essential for addressing a variety of common problems that can develop over time or due to severe weather events. For example, storm damage can cause shingles to lift or break, leading to leaks and water damage inside the home. Aging roofs may develop cracks, curling, or missing shingles that compromise their ability to protect the property. Additionally, improper installation or lack of maintenance can result in issues like clogged gutters or damaged flashing. Detecting these problems early can prevent more costly repairs and help maintain the roof’s integrity and the home’s overall safety.

Property owners in Sturgis, MI may seek roof damage inspection services after experiencing severe weather, such as heavy storms or hail, that can cause visible dents, cracks, or missing shingles. Additionally, signs like water stains on ceilings or walls, increased energy bills, or the presence of granules from shingles in gutters can prompt homeowners to have a professional evaluate their roof’s condition. Routine inspections are also common for those who want to catch small issues early before they develop into costly repairs, especially in areas where seasonal weather can impact roof integrity.
Local contractors in Sturgis are available to assess damage caused by fallen branches, ice buildup, or aging materials that may no longer provide adequate protection. Property owners might also look for inspection services if they notice uneven roof surfaces, sagging areas, or leaks after storms or windy days. What are common signs of roof damage? Signs of roof damage include missing or broken shingles, water stains on ceilings or walls, and visible sagging or curling of roof materials.
How can a roof damage inspection help homeowners? An inspection can identify underlying issues early, preventing further deterioration and potential costly repairs down the line.
What areas do roof damage inspections typically cover? Inspections usually assess shingles, flashing, gutters, vents, and the overall structure of the roof to detect damage or vulnerabilities.
Are roof damage inspections suitable after severe weather events? Yes, inspections are especially recommended after storms, hail, or high winds to evaluate any potential damage caused by such conditions.
How do local contractors perform roof damage assessments? Contractors typically examine the roof visually, check for signs of wear or damage, and may use tools or equipment to assess hard-to-see areas.
